Islam, 40, has won first prize - a fabulous 14-inch color television - in a contest sponsored by officials at the Agriculture Research Council of Bangladesh in order to cut down on the pesky, crop eating rodents.
Bangaladesh officials, in an effort to cut the 1-1/2 to 2 million tons of food eaten or destroyed by the rats per year in their nation. They asked that farmers make a concerted effort, like a sport, of killing off the rats.
Nearly 500 farmers and officials gathered at an official ceremony to thank Islam and watch him receive his shiny new television set.
Islam told onlookers that he used poison to kill the rats, and collected their tails as proof of his accomplishments - 83,000 of them!
Runner-up Fakhrul Akanda, who himself killed over 37,000 rats, mostly with traps, also won a television set for his efforts to help "educate and motivate others to join him" said the busy farmer, per AP.
